What grades do I need to study in Canada?

A minimum qualification required to apply for undergraduate studies is completion of 12 years of schooling. As such, you can apply with either Canadian Grade 12 (also known in Malaysia as ICPU or CIMP), STPM, “A” Level, International Baccalaureate, US/Australian Year 12 or in some cases the UEC. A couple of Universities will also consider admitting students with excellent SPM results.

In addition to the above qualifications, international students must also show proof of English proficiency such as IBT TOEFL (score of 79 to 100) or IELTS (band of 6.0 to 7.5).
